Yamaha Announces New Digital Combo
January 19, 2001
Advertisement
Responding to the popular demand of guitarists everywhere, Yamaha Pro Audio & Combo Division, Guitar Products, combines the features of its award-winning DG80 digital guitar amplifier and the new DG Stomp preamp in the DG60FX-112 60-watt, 1x12 combo amp at Winter NAMM 2001. The affordably priced DG60FX-112 is at home in the studio, on the stage or on the road, and is currently available. Players of all genres will benefit from the amp's versatility and variety of on-board amp sounds and effects. These include: eight amp types using proprietary ECM technology for tube-tone emulation, modulation effects (chorus, flanger, phaser, tape echo, delay and tremolo), three reverbs and a compressor. The unit also features 180 patches (90 preset/90 user) and a fully programmable "wah" with optional expression pedal. "The DG60FX-112 provides guitarists with an amplified version of the popular DG Stomp," states David Bergstrom, director of marketing, Combo Group. "Like the other DG products, we've incorporated cutting-edge technology, yet kept it surprisingly affordable." Sixteen cabinet types, both vintage and contemporary, are available for the DG60FX-112, and are available in a variety of configurations. The units also contains a user-friendly input and output design, 48K digital output for direct digital recording, an input for connecting an optional Yamaha FC7 expression pedal (to produce "wah" and effects control) and a line/headphone out.
